Turbocharger A turbocharger is the heart of a turbo petrol engine. It's a turbine-driven air compressor that increases the amount of air entering the engine, allowing it to burn more fuel and produce more power. A turbocharger consists of two main parts: a turbine and a compressor. The turbine is driven by the engine's exhaust gases, while the compressor compresses the air entering the engine. Intercooler An intercooler is a heat exchanger that cools the compressed air from the turbocharger before it enters the engine. Cooler air is denser and contains more oxygen, which allows the engine to burn more fuel and produce more power. The intercooler is usually mounted in front of the radiator, where it receives a constant flow of air. Fuel Injectors Fuel injectors are responsible for delivering fuel to the engine's combustion chamber. In a turbo petrol engine, the fuel injectors need to be larger than those in a naturally aspirated engine to deliver the additional fuel required to produce more power. The fuel injectors are controlled by the engine's computer, which adjusts the fuel delivery based on the engine's load and speed. Exhaust System An exhaust system is responsible for removing the engine's exhaust gases. In a turbo petrol engine, the exhaust system needs to be designed to reduce backpressure, allowing the engine to expel exhaust gases more efficiently. A well-designed exhaust system can also improve the engine's performance by reducing turbo lag, which is the delay between pressing the accelerator pedal and the turbocharger delivering boost. Engine Management System The engine management system is the brain of a turbo petrol engine. It controls the fuel delivery, ignition timing, turbocharger boost pressure, and other parameters to optimize the engine's performance and efficiency. A well-tuned engine management system can significantly improve the engine's performance, while also ensuring that it meets emissions regulations.
